Hey Priya,

Handing over the locale stuff before my leave. The extraction script pulls translatable strings from the Fernwhistle repo nightly and stashes them in the i18n database for the translators' dashboard. If it jams, just rerun it — it's idempotent. It reads its target database from an env var, which should be set to this connection string.

primary connection of yagep-kahip = redis://giliel_svc:zYiKsLL2PLpfPL@db-348f.xolmarsys.corp:5432/fenwyn

Subject: Deep-link cut-over complete

Hi all — the mobile deep-link routing cut-over for the Lanternfield app finished last night. Old scheme links now redirect through the new Waypost resolver, and the legacy handler is in read-only mode until it's retired next sprint. We saw a brief spike in fallback traffic during the switch, which settled within an hour. New joiners: please familiarize yourselves with the resolver before picking up routing tickets. For reference, the routing service is currently running with the configuration below.

service settings:
PRAIX_LOG_LEVEL=error
PRAIX_METRICS_HOST=metrics.praix.qorvelcorp.corp
PRAIX_POOL_SIZE=16

## Account Recovery — Trailnote Offline Mode

When a surveyor's Trailnote app has been offline for 30+ days, their local credentials expire and sync refuses to resume. Don't make them wipe the device — all their unsynced field data lives there! Instead, open the support console, pick "Offline Reinstate," and enter their handle. The console will ask for the support team's shared recovery passphrase before issuing a reinstatement token. Use the one below.

unlock words, bagaf-fajeg: zorael-kelax-fraath-quenix-eliok-sileth-aldmir-wenir-druiel